This is my favourite box art. Assuming the decals for the Gnat are for their first appearance as the Reds? (Just read the fine print at the Airfix site:

The colour scheme provided for the Gnat represents the first season in 1965 and the Hawk scheme includes the new tail fin design for 2014, thus creating models of both the very first and the most up-to-date Red Arrow aircraft. Both models fully replicate the graceful lines and the red, white and blue colours schemes of the real aircraft.

Paint Scheme - Red Arrows Folland Gnat, Royal Air Force, Fairford, 1964/65 and BAe Hawk, Royal Air Force, Scampton, 2014" Edited by tonyp
